Dealing with change and loss
What the course is about
This course explores the deep connection between immigration and the experience of grief and loss. It offers insights into the symptoms of culture shock and the stages of grief, and their impact on personal well-being. Participants will learn to recognize symptoms of unresolved grief and explore strategies to navigate the emotional challenges of immigration and adaptation.
Time allocation: 41 min. of videos + 20-40 min. of independent activity


What you will gain
-
Familiarize with the concept and symptoms of culture shock.
-
Identify the stages of grief and the common symptomatic behaviours specific to the experience of immigration.
-
Recognize the effects of unresolved grieving on behaviours and performance in general, and in the workplace in particular.
-
Identify own current state of mind and explore ways to overcome the challenges associated with the grieving process.
